285 5 AVENUE is an 8-unit building in Park Slope, Brooklyn, built in 1921.

1 unit is on the market here right now.

City records show 5 DOB permits and 37 open violations on file.

Reading these records

The transaction history above comes from ACRIS, the city's register of recorded deeds - it shows what actually closed, not what was asked.
